WebIn Queensland the cooling-off period is an initial phase at the beginning of a conveyance where the Buyer can rightfully withdraw from the contract and cancel the transaction for any valid reason. The duration extends from the moment the Buyer has received the signed contract and ends five business days after at 5:00 pm on the fifth day.

WebYour contract should comply with Schedule 1B of the QBCC Act 1994, which includes a right to a ‘cooling off’ period – usually over a time-frame of five business days. If you withdraw from the contract during the cooling off period, you must notify the builder in writing and may be required to pay them a $100 out-of-pocket expenses fee.
